ddidderr caf12dda22 feat(rust): port divsufsort
Move the dictionary builder's suffix-array construction from
lib/dictBuilder/divsufsort.c to rust/src/divsufsort.rs, the first
dictBuilder module to migrate.  It rides on the dict-builder cargo
feature dimension introduced by the previous commit.

divsufsort() is a self-contained algorithm (two-stage sort of type-B*
substrings via sssort, rank refinement via trsort, then induced sorting
of the full array), so its context-free signature allows a direct symbol
takeover: the Rust #[no_mangle] export provides the existing `divsufsort`
symbol and the C file becomes a declaration-only shim that just keeps the
header's prototypes in the build.  Only divsufsort() moved; divbwt() has
no callers anywhere in zstd, so it is now declaration-only, keeping the
Rust export surface minimal.  The unused openMP parameter is retained for
signature compatibility (zstd never defines LIBBSC_OPENMP).

The port is a mechanical translation of the exact configuration zstd
compiles: ALPHABET_SIZE=256, SS_INSERTIONSORT_THRESHOLD=8,
SS_BLOCKSIZE=1024, SS_MISORT_STACKSIZE=16, SS_SMERGE_STACKSIZE=32,
TR_STACKSIZE=64.  Every C `int*` cursor into the SA buffer becomes an
`isize` index into a single `&mut [i32]` slice, preserving the pointer
arithmetic (including transient one-before-the-range cursors and the
bitwise-complement rank marking) while staying bounds-checked; all value
arithmetic keeps C int semantics.  The C -1/-2 error results are
preserved, with Vec::try_reserve_exact standing in for the bucket-array
malloc failure path.  Behavior is bit-identical by construction and by
measurement (see test plan); runtime on an 11 MB training buffer is
within ~5% of the C build end-to-end.

Users see no behavioral change: dictionaries trained through
ZDICT_trainFromBuffer_legacy() are byte-identical to the C build.  The
only external difference is that the never-called `divbwt` symbol is no
longer defined in the library.

ddidderr 91c80fc8e7 build(rust): add dict-builder cargo feature dimension
The dictionary-builder sources (lib/dictBuilder) are about to start moving
to Rust, beginning with divsufsort. The Rust crate previously only modeled
the compression/decompression module split plus the forced-HUF decoder
modes, so no build could express "this C configuration includes (or
excludes) dictBuilder" to Cargo. Without that, a Rust archive could carry
dictBuilder modules into a build whose C side disabled them, or worse,
omit a migrated implementation from a build whose C shims require it.

Add a `dict-builder` cargo feature and thread it through every build that
consumes the Rust static archive, mirroring exactly how each build system
already gates the dictBuilder C sources:

- rust/Cargo.toml: new `dict-builder` feature, included in the default
  set because the C library builds dictBuilder by default
  (ZSTD_LIB_DICTBUILDER ?= 1). The feature is empty until the first
  dictBuilder module lands.
- lib/Makefile: RUST_CARGO_FEATURES gains dict-builder when
  ZSTD_LIB_DICTBUILDER is enabled, following the existing
  ZSTD_LIB_COMPRESSION/ZSTD_LIB_DECOMPRESSION pattern. The archive
  directory naming grows a matching `b<0|1>` dimension
  (c1-d1-b1-default etc.) so differently configured archives never
  collide; the repeated config prefix is factored into
  RUST_MODULE_CONFIG.
- programs/Makefile: the full-featured archives now request
  compression,decompression,dict-builder (equal to the default set, so
  the target directory stays shared with tests). The partial-library
  variants gain the `b0` name dimension, and zstd-dictBuilder gets its
  own lib-c1-d0-b1 archive because it compiles the dictBuilder C sources
  without decompression; it previously shared the compression-only
  archive, which will lack the migrated dictBuilder symbols.
- tests/Makefile: no flag change needed since tests use the crate default
  feature set; a comment now records that dict-builder arrives that way.
- build/cmake/lib/CMakeLists.txt: ZSTD_BUILD_DICTBUILDER now adds the
  dict-builder feature and a `b<0|1>` component in the Rust build-config
  directory name, in lockstep with the DictBuilderSources gating.
- build/meson/lib/meson.build: meson compiles the dictBuilder sources
  unconditionally, so the feature list and config name gain dict-builder
  unconditionally (c1-d1-b1-<huf-mode>).

The `dict-builder` feature deliberately does not imply `compression`.
lib/Makefile forces ZSTD_LIB_DICTBUILDER=0 when compression is disabled,
but CMake does not couple the two options, so encoding the C-side
constraint in Cargo would make the Rust archive diverge from the C source
list in that (already unsupported) CMake configuration.

ddidderr 25f2aa9502 feat(cli): support --single-thread in the Rust frontend
The Rust CLI frontend rejected --single-thread, but tests/playTests.sh
uses it 28 times, so the flag is required before the original CLI test
suite can gate the migration.

Mirror the C zstdcli.c semantics: --single-thread pins zero workers and
sets a latch that suppresses the automatic core-count resolution, so
fileio receives nbWorkers == 0 and runs its single-thread streaming
mode (slightly different from -T1, which uses one worker thread).  A
bare zero from -T0 or the zstdmt program name still auto-detects the
core count, and a later -T# overrides the pinned worker count while the
latch stays set, exactly as the C variable pair behaved.

ddidderr 529cd297e2 feat(rust): port compression-parameter selection
Move the context-free compression-parameter logic of zstd_compress.c to
rust/src/zstd_compress_params.rs: the compression-level tables (formerly
clevels.h), parameter bounds/checking/clamping, cycle log, level-table
selection, source/dictionary parameter adjustment, default frame
parameters, and the match-state/CDict size estimators.

The boundary follows the module's design notes: Rust owns only leaves
whose behavior is independent of C preprocessor configuration.  C keeps
the public ZSTD_* symbols and feeds the leaves everything that is
configuration-owned as explicit scalars:

- The ZSTD_EXCLUDE_*_BLOCK_COMPRESSOR strategy cascade stays in
  ZSTD_adjustCParams_internal() ahead of the Rust adjustment leaf, so
  reduced builds keep their fallback policy.
- Workspace estimation receives struct sizes (ZSTD_CDict, ZSTD_match_t,
  ZSTD_optimal_t), HUF workspace size, and the sanitizer redzone size,
  because those depend on private layouts and ASAN configuration.
- ZSTD_cParam_getBounds() forwards only the compression level and the
  seven core parameters; all other parameter bounds remain C.
- Frozen private constants the leaves hardcode (short-cache and row-hash
  tag widths, MaxML/MaxLL/MaxOff/Litbits, ZSTD_OPT_SIZE, cwksp alignment)
  are pinned by ZSTD_STATIC_ASSERTs at the C call sites.

Two latent 32-bit bugs in the previously unwired module were fixed
before integration: dictAndWindowLog's max window size and the
window-resize threshold were hardcoded to the 64-bit constants
(1<<31, 1<<30) instead of deriving from ZSTD_WINDOWLOG_MAX, which is
30 on 32-bit targets.

clevels.h is no longer included anywhere but stays in-tree as the
reference for mechanical comparison against the Rust table.
